Manufacturer Narrative
The used device has not been analyzed since it could not be obtained from the customer.In addition, we could not investigate manufacturing and quality control records based on the lot number since it is unknown.The event is considered an allergic reaction and the customer commented that the patient could only be triggered by eating a ham, butter and cheese sandwich a few minutes before the development of pruritus on (b)(6).The treatment method will be changed to immuno-adsorption from the next treatment.We considered that this incident serious since the patient's systolic blood pressure dropped to 70 mmhg, and that the causal relationship could not be denied since the symptom appeared during treatment.Hypotonia is described in warning of the instructions for use as "monitor the patient constantly during treatment with the plasmaflo op.In the event of any of the following (hypotonia) during treatment, immediately ensure the safety of the patient and take appropriate measures in accordance with the directions of the responsible physician.We will continue to monitor similar complaints carefully.
 
Event Description
The patient's primary disease is hypercholesterolemia due to a homozygous variant of ldl cholesterol, which has been treated with ldl apheresis since she was (b)(6) years old.The facility has been implementing the double filtration plasmapheresis for the patient since 2015.On (b)(6) 2019, the patient was treated with plasmaflo op-08w(l) and cascadeflo ec.She suffered from pruritus, especially on the scalp 120 minutes after the start of treatment.The pruritus was associated with infiltrated macular rash located in the hair, the forehead, the cheeks and the neck.These symptoms were associated with a tingling sensation, followed by noticeable angioedema on both the lips and tongue without dyspnea and bronchospasm.The ige value was 336 ui / l, and tryptase was normal both at the time of the event and 30 minutes after the event.Compared to the previous treatment, there was no change in the treatment protocol.The patient's medication did not change, either.These events were treated with polaramine and adrenaline.The ldl treatment has been stopped and the patient stayed the whole day at the hospital for follow-up.Since the symptoms did not recur, cetirizine was prescribed at 10 mg/day for 10 days and she went back home.On (b)(6) 2019, the patient was treated with plasmaflo op-08w(l) and cascadeflo ec.75 minutes after the start of treatment, she suffered from facial and chest erythroses, pruritus, followed by hives and tongue angioedema and then the treatment was discontinued.The ige value was 369 ui / l, and the tryptase value was normal.On (b)(6) 2019, the patient was treated with plasmaflo op-08w(l) and rheofilter er.Cascadeflo ec was changed to rheofilter er and the patient was pre-administered with polaramine before treatment.90 minutes after the start of treatment, rash occurred and systolic blood pressure dropped to 70 mmhg, therefore treatment was discontinued.Plasmaflo op-08w(l) is a plasma separator which is similar product of plasmaflo op-05w(a) marketed in us.
